![]() ![]() ![]() There’s often nothing else available to stuff clothes and belongings in when children are moved from home to home while in foster care. The Garbage Bag Suitcase in the title is a reference to the number of times kids in care often move houses. Truly heartbreaking and poignant, The Garbage Bag Suitcase is a story of a young woman’s success despite aging out of a child welfare system that is badly broken. It’s a sad, brave and very real story that is not at all uncommon, but is rarely told. After years of this abuse and neglect, the young girl bravely makes the choice to commit herself to foster care at age of 13. Shenandoah is treated abusively by her stepfather, and neglected by her beautiful but drug addled mother and moves homes in the middle of the night many times over with a mother that is not fit to parent. ![]() The Garbage Bag Suitcase is a truly powerful memoir of a young girl who was chronically neglected by her substance abusing parents. ![]()
